Artificial intelligence (AI) models show high accuracy in detecting and quantifying orthodontically induced root resorption (OIRR) using cone-beam computed tomography (CBCT). These AI tools demonstrate excellent agreement with expert assessments, supporting their clinical use in orthodontics.

Background:
- Orthodontically induced root resorption (OIRR) is a common adverse effect of orthodontic treatment.
- Accurate detection and quantification of OIRR are crucial for patient care.
Purpose of the Study:
- To systematically review and meta-analyze the diagnostic performance of AI models for OIRR detection using CBCT.
- To evaluate AI model agreement with manual assessments and explore factors influencing performance.
Main Methods:
- A comprehensive literature search was conducted across major databases.
- Seven studies employing AI for OIRR diagnosis on CBCT were included.
- A random-effect meta-analysis and subgroup analyses were performed following PRISMA guidelines.
Main Results:
- AI models demonstrated high pooled sensitivity (0.903) and excellent specificity (82%-98%).
- Area under the ROC curve reached up to 0.96, indicating strong diagnostic capability.
- Near-perfect agreement (ICC=1.000) was observed between AI and manual quantification.
Conclusions:
- AI models applied to CBCT show excellent diagnostic accuracy for OIRR detection.
- AI exhibits high concordance with expert assessments, suggesting potential for clinical integration.
- Further research may refine AI model architecture and validation for optimal performance.
